How they compare
Nigeria currently reports 0.3233 units per square kilometre against 0.047 units per square kilometre in Sub-Saharan Africa (excluding high income), a difference of 0.2763 units per square kilometre.
That makes Nigeria's figure about 6.9 times Sub-Saharan Africa (excluding high income)'s.
Across all 34 years both countries report, Nigeria has been ahead every year.
Nigeria ranks 5th and Sub-Saharan Africa (excluding high income) ranks 8th of 195 countries.
Nigeria has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

About this data
Number of neonatal deaths divided by Land area (sq. km),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
